Re: Retirement of the Stonebriar product line

Stonebriar sales have declined for five consecutive quarters and support costs now exceed contribution margin. The retirement plan is staged: new orders close end of Q2, existing contracts honoured through their terms, and spares stocked for twenty-four months. Sales leads should steer prospects toward the Ashgrove range; migration incentives are already approved. Customer comms are drafted and awaiting legal sign-off. The forward strategy behind this decision is set out in the note below.

confidential, yafog-hagug: Gross margin on Druix came in at 10 percent against a plan of 15 percent. Only 5 of the 80 pilot accounts renewed Druix, so a churn review is set for October 1.

## 3.2.0 — Changed defaults

Date localization in Fennel now defaults to the viewer's locale instead of the tenant locale. Plugins that relied on tenant-wide formats must opt back in via the formatting hook. The old `fixedFormat` flag is deprecated and ignored after 3.4. Week-start and numeral shaping also follow locale now. Test against the Harrowgate sandbox before release. New default values shipped with this release are listed below.

settings of tagef-bawif:
DRUIX_HOST=druix.zemvarlabs.internal
DRUIX_PORT=8000

Runbook: log compaction on the Meadowfork queue. Compaction runs hourly and collapses superseded messages per key, keeping only the latest payload plus tombstones for 48 hours. Before forcing a manual compaction, confirm no consumer group lags beyond the tombstone window — otherwise that consumer will miss deletions and rehydrate stale state. Pause the Ostler mirror first, run the compactor with the dry-run flag, review the reclaim estimate, then execute. Record the outcome in the ops journal along with the broker build, noted here:

build token for fawef-bawif: htk21_a456c2b3baaca3c947e20